Nice pics Valley! I'm pretty familiar with a lot of that road. We used to drive north from the San Diego area to get to the Sierras. Mostly we'd go up 395 and turn at Toms Place and on up to Rock Creek. We did a lot of camping and backpacking in from there. Beautiful area. Or we'd go further north and go up Tioga Pass into Yosemite.
I preferred the backside (east side) of the Sierras more because the drive was more pleasant once you got through all the megalopolis of Sandiegolosangelesandmore. The west side access just involved more congestion. But that's been years, maybe both sides are just as heavily trafficked now
